Simply Magical Vacations by Amy
BackBased in Knoxville, Tennessee, Simply Magical Vacations by Amy, operated by Amy Shewmake, presents itself as a specialized travel agency focused on creating personalized and stress-free travel experiences. The agency’s name strongly suggests a deep focus on Disney-related destinations, a perception that is largely accurate and constitutes one of its primary strengths. However, client testimonials and a broader look at its offerings reveal a more diverse portfolio that extends to international destinations, cruises, and all-inclusive resorts. This agency aims to serve clients who are looking for a high-touch, concierge-level of vacation planning, moving beyond the transactional nature of online booking platforms.
Strengths and Service Highlights
The most prominent advantage of engaging with this agency is the depth of specialized knowledge, particularly for complex family destinations. Multiple clients, from seasoned Disney visitors to first-timers, have noted the immense value Amy provides. For one family planning a trip for a five-year-old after an eight-year hiatus from Disney World, the process was initially intimidating. The agent stepped in to manage every detail, from selecting the right resort and parks to booking dining reservations and even recommending age-appropriate rides. This level of granular support is a significant asset for travelers facing the information overload typical of modern trip planner tools.
This expertise is not confined to a single type of traveler. One client praised the agency for making their multi-generational trip with a large party of 12 seamless and memorable. Another long-time Disney-goer found that working with a professional travel agent introduced new tips and tricks that enhanced their experience, proving that even experienced travelers can benefit from professional consultation. This hands-on approach is consistently described by clients as attentive, compassionate, and first-class.
Diversified Travel Portfolio
While the branding leans heavily on "magical" vacations, client experiences demonstrate a robust capability to plan a wide array of trips. The agency has successfully organized bucket-list journeys to Ireland and Scotland for a 45th wedding anniversary and romantic anniversary getaways to Sandals resorts in St. Lucia. This indicates a strong competence in crafting custom itineraries and honeymoon packages that cater to different interests and occasions. The official service description further expands this scope, noting specializations in cruise vacations and a focus on creating comfortable and accessible travel for older adults. This demonstrates a versatility that might not be immediately apparent from the business name alone.
The Power of Affiliation
A crucial factor contributing to the agency's credibility is its affiliation with Magical Vacation Planner, a nationally recognized, Diamond-level Authorized Disney Vacation Planner. This partnership provides the best of both worlds: clients receive the dedicated, one-on-one service of a personal travel agent like Amy, while also benefiting from the resources, industry connections, and potential for exclusive travel deals of a major travel company. This structure alleviates potential concerns about relying on a small, independent operator, as the backing of a larger, reputable organization provides a significant layer of security and support.
Potential Drawbacks and Client Considerations
Despite the overwhelmingly positive feedback, there are practical and perceptual factors that potential clients should consider. These points are not necessarily negative but reflect the specific business model and operational realities of the agency.
Limited Operating Hours
The agency's physical office hours are relatively constrained, typically running from 9:30 AM to 3:30 PM on weekdays and for a shorter period on Saturdays. For prospective clients working traditional 9-to-5 jobs, this schedule can make real-time phone consultations challenging without taking time off from work. While communication via email is standard, those who prefer immediate, direct conversation may need to be more deliberate in scheduling their interactions. This contrasts with the 24/7 accessibility of online booking engines, highlighting the trade-off between constant access and personalized, expert service.
Branding and Niche Perception
The name "Simply Magical Vacations" is highly effective for its target market but may inadvertently deter travelers seeking different kinds of experiences. A client looking for rugged adventure travel, budget backpacking tours, or highly independent itineraries might overlook the agency, assuming its services are limited to theme parks and luxury resorts. While evidence shows the agency handles diverse destinations, the branding creates a strong initial impression that may not appeal to all segments of the travel market.
The Role of the Intermediary
Working with any travel agency means adding an intermediary to the planning process. For travelers who enjoy micromanaging their plans and prefer to make changes directly with airlines or hotels, this can be a point of friction. Any modifications to a reservation, such as changing dates or canceling a booking, must be handled through the agent. While this is a standard industry practice designed to streamline the process, it requires a level of trust and relinquishing of direct control that not every traveler is comfortable with. However, this structure proved invaluable for one client who missed a flight due to an accident; the agent was actively rebooking and providing airport navigation assistance in real-time, a service impossible to get from an automated website.
The Client Experience
Based on extensive reviews, the process of working with Simply Magical Vacations by Amy is straightforward and client-centric. It begins with a consultation to understand the traveler's needs, budget, and vision. From there, the agency takes over the logistical heavy lifting—researching options, securing bookings, managing payments, and providing a clear itinerary. The service is designed to remove the stress and time commitment from the client, allowing them to focus on the anticipation of their trip. The high rating of 4.8 stars across more than 20 reviews underscores a consistent record of customer satisfaction. Clients repeatedly use words like "knowledgeable," "helpful," and "seamless" to describe their experience, pointing to a reliable and effective service for those seeking expertly planned family vacations and group travel.
